Recent changes to NYS Education Law require that BMI and Weight Status Group be included as part of the student's school health examination. These numbers help the doctor or nurse know if the student's weight is in a healthy range or is too high or too low.
NYS Department of Health will be conducting a yearly survey in which schools will need to report information about our student's weight status groups. The information sent to the NYSDOH will help health officials develop programs that make it easier for children to be healthier. Only summary information is sent. No names and no information about individual students are sent. You may choose to have your child's information excluded from this survey.
If you do not wish to have your child's weight status group information included as part of the Health Department's survey, please contact the school nurse for the building your child(ren) attend.

Senior Elizabeth Schwartz is the 2009 recipient of the the "Go Get It" Scholarship. This scholarship is generously donated by Lake Shore alumnus, Heather Tilert, who is now a producer in the entertainment business in New York City. The scholarship comes in the amount of $1000.00 and is given to a Lake Shore graduate who has serious plans to "go get it" and fulfill his or her dreams.
